.\" -*- coding: UTF-8 -*- '\" t .\" Copyright (C) 2001 Andries Brouwer .\" .\" SPDX-License-Identifier: Linux-man-pages-copyleft .\" .\"******************************************************************* .\" .\" This file was generated with po4a. Translate the source file. .\" .\"******************************************************************* .TH timegm 3 "20 июля 2023 г." "Linux man\-pages 6.05.01" .SH ИМЯ timegm, timelocal \- обратные gmtime и localtime функции .SH LIBRARY Standard C library (\fIlibc\fP, \fI\-lc\fP) .SH СИНТАКСИС .nf \fB#include \fP .PP \fB[[deprecated]] time_t timelocal(struct tm *\fP\fItm\fP\fB);\fP \fBtime_t timegm(struct tm *\fP\fItm\fP\fB);\fP .PP .fi .RS -4 Требования макроса тестирования свойств для glibc (см. \fBfeature_test_macros\fP(7)): .RE .PP \fBtimelocal\fP(), \fBtimegm\fP(): .nf начиная с glibc 2.19: _DEFAULT_SOURCE в glibc 2.19 и старее: _BSD_SOURCE || _SVID_SOURCE .fi .SH ОПИСАНИЕ \fBtimelocal\fP() и \fBtimegm\fP() являются обратными функциями по отношению к \fBlocaltime\fP(3) и \fBgmtime\fP(3). Обе функции принимают разделенное на составные части время и преобразуют его в календарное (измеряемое в секундах от начала Эпохи 1970\-01\-01 00:00:00 +0000, UTC). Различие между функциями заключается в том, что \fBtimelocal\fP() во время преобразования принимает во внимание локальный часовой пояс, когда как \fBtimegm\fP() во входном параметре использует Всемирное координированное время (Coordinated Universal Time, UTC). .SH "ВОЗВРАЩАЕМОЕ ЗНАЧЕНИЕ" On success, these functions return the calendar time (seconds since the Epoch), expressed as a value of type \fItime_t\fP. On error, they return the value \fI(time_t)\ \-1\fP and set \fIerrno\fP to indicate the error. .SH ОШИБКИ .TP \fBEOVERFLOW\fP Результат не может быть представлен. .SH АТРИБУТЫ Описание терминов данного раздела смотрите в \fBattributes\fP(7). .TS allbox; lbx lb lb l l l. Интерфейс Атрибут Значение T{ .na .nh \fBtimelocal\fP(), \fBtimegm\fP() T} Безвредность в нитях MT\-Safe env locale .TE .sp 1 .SH СТАНДАРТЫ BSD. .SH ИСТОРИЯ GNU, BSD. .PP Функция \fBtimelocal\fP() эквивалентна стандартной функции POSIX \fBmktime\fP(3). Нет ни одной причины когда\-либо её использовать. .SH "СМ. ТАКЖЕ" \fBgmtime\fP(3), \fBlocaltime\fP(3), \fBmktime\fP(3), \fBtzset\fP(3) .PP .SH ПЕРЕВОД Русский перевод этой страницы руководства был сделан Azamat Hackimov , Dmitry Bolkhovskikh , Yuri Kozlov и Иван Павлов . .PP Этот перевод является бесплатной документацией; прочитайте .UR https://www.gnu.org/licenses/gpl-3.0.html Стандартную общественную лицензию GNU версии 3 .UE или более позднюю, чтобы узнать об условиях авторского права. Мы не несем НИКАКОЙ ОТВЕТСТВЕННОСТИ. .PP Если вы обнаружите ошибки в переводе этой страницы руководства, пожалуйста, отправьте электронное письмо на .MT man-pages-ru-talks@lists.sourceforge.net .ME .